EDOTCO Bangladesh and Narayanganj City Corporation Partner to Enhance Urban Connectivity with Smart Infrastructure

In a landmark move toward enhancing urban digital connectivity, EDOTCO Bangladesh has signed a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) with Narayanganj City Corporation (NCC). This partnership marks the official rollout of Street Furniture (SF), a next-generation telecommunications infrastructure solution designed to meet the growing demand for reliable mobile network coverage in urban areas.


The collaboration signifies a shared commitment to building a smarter, more connected city by integrating telecommunications solutions into the existing urban landscape. With increasing population density and rising data consumption, the need for seamless, high-quality connectivity has never been more critical. This initiative supports both network efficiency and sustainable urban development, ensuring that connectivity remains a key enabler of progress in Narayanganj.


Street Furniture: The Future of Urban Connectivity


As cities evolve, the demand for digital infrastructure must be met without compromising aesthetics or public spaces. Traditional telecom towers, while essential, often require significant space and may not always blend seamlessly into modern city environments. Street Furniture offers a compact, multi-functional alternative, allowing for the efficient deployment of network infrastructure without disrupting the urban landscape.


Unlike conventional telecom towers, Street Furniture is designed to integrate with public infrastructure such as streetlights, bus stops, and utility poles, making it an ideal solution for areas where space constraints limit the installation of larger structures. These installations not only provide enhanced network coverage and capacity but also support additional features that benefit city residents.


The implementation of Street Furniture aligns with NCC’s smart city vision, ensuring that telecommunications infrastructure does not just serve a functional role but also contributes to the broader goals of sustainability, safety, and urban modernization.


A Partnership for Smarter Cities


The signing of the MoU between EDOTCO Bangladesh and Narayanganj City Corporation reflects a growing recognition of the role public-private partnerships play in accelerating digital infrastructure development. As Bangladesh moves toward becoming a Smart Nation, partnerships like these are essential to ensuring that cities remain at the forefront of technological advancements.


The introduction of Street Furniture in Narayanganj represents a major step forward in the digital transformation of Bangladesh. By leveraging smart infrastructure solutions, EDOTCO Bangladesh is not only addressing immediate network coverage challenges but also laying the groundwork for a future-ready telecommunications ecosystem.


The success of this initiative could serve as a model for other cities looking to enhance connectivity while maintaining urban aesthetics. As demand for 5G and high-speed data continues to grow, infrastructure innovations like Street Furniture will play a crucial role in ensuring sustainable, efficient, and widespread connectivity.
